Transaction f66c590ace8c6c5963c970e612676dcb37894f4620faa240a8edd66ff721a6a5
1 Input
1 Output
-
f66c590ace8c6c5963c970e612676dcb37894f4620faa240a8edd66ff721a6a5:0
- value
- 21088
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 2ba4eac31f3ad988d7db1df8ab9b64501a907e5896a12e86d8dac87461ec94e2
- address
- bc1p9wjw4scl8tvc347mrhu2hxmy2qdfqljcj6sjapkcmty8gc0vjn3qw3lyhn